Dr. Li-Fang Chu, University of Calgary

NanoLuc® Luciferase Live-Cell Imaging

The development of the human embryo is a complicated process that involves careful coordination of thousands of genes. Dr. Li-Fang Chu, Assistant Professor at the University of Calgary, is interested in studying the developmental clock and how it is regulated. Using bioluminescence live-cell imaging, his group visualized expression levels of a segmentation clock gene, HES7, in a human embryonic stem cell model.
